GNDEC beats slowdown as students land lucrative pacts

Punj Lloyd, a trans-national company specialising in energy and infrastructure sectors conducted a grand joint campus placement drive at Guru Nanak Dev Engineering College (GNDEC) recently.

The company officials, Basab Acharya (GM), Rohit (Manager, HR) and Pooja (Procurement Department) were present for the selection process. Around 200 students from GNDEC, Ludhiana, Guru Nanak dev Polytechnic College, Ludhiana and Sant Longowal Institute of Engineering Technology (SLIET), Longowal, appeared for the written test which consisted of both aptitude and technical portions. This test was followed by group discussions and personal interviews.

Among the selected students were Vivek Jha, Harmeet Singh, Dilraj Singh, Gaurav Puri, Harsimranjeet Singh, Jasmeet Singh Gill, Joginder Singh, Kumar Keshav Sood.

Apart from these, many other students have been shortlisted. The company has offered a package of 6 lacs with lucrative perks as well as international exposure in countries like UK, Singapore, Malaysia and many more.

The Principal, Dr M S Saini has congratulated dean Training and Placement cell, Prof. K S Mann and Deputy dean S K Singla for their concerted efforts which made this placement drive possible.
